一直想写这篇文章很长时间了,今天又看到一篇帖子实在忍不住来聊几句
日常一直加了几个技术群,并且混到了一个推荐系统几千人的管理员(其实是日常灌水比较多...)。其中经常见到的一种场景是一个新人入群后就是一句话“有没有大佬精通 Ctr(此处可以替换为任何技术名词)的啊”,然后群里一片寂然,再然后就没有然后了。这种情况见了太多了以至于都见怪不怪,甚至还会有人因此抱怨群里的气氛对新人不友好。
但说真的,这种现象发生最主要的还是主要还是问问题的方式不对。
①上来就是以“大佬”开始称呼,其实就默认了回答提问的人都是大佬,平白无故被盖上一顶高帽是任何人都不喜欢的事。更何况在这种情况下彼此都心知肚明所谓“大佬”的称呼纯粹是敷衍了事。就算是有人知道答案也会害怕以后就被人大佬大佬地叫而故意不去回答。
②相信提问者也是想问一个具体的问题,他期待的场景是有人回应一句后他再抛出具体的问题出来。但实际中大家都很忙,真的没有精力去问你具体是什么问题,哪怕是同一项技术,从事的方向不同也近乎于隔行如隔山。如果问你之后发现自己刚好不会这方面的内容那就简直是尴尬要死。为了避免这个问题的发生还是不说话为好。之前在一个 Spark 群里就亲眼见了这个事情,一个人上来就是问"有没有知道 Spark 的啊",语气问题不多讨论,然后一个 Spark committer 就回复问什么问题,本来都以为是执行优化或者是代码问题,最后问的是一个安装过程中出现的错误。然后那位就回复说他们公司都是有专人负责安装,他不知道怎么解决。如果能提前说好是安装问题的话也不至于双方都浪费时间。
那么怎么问技术问题比较好呢?根据在群里的观察,得到回复率比较高的提问一般格式为:“大家好,最近遇到 XXX 的问题,我们相出了 XXX 的方法但不知道哪个更好 /我们没有解决办法,不知道各位有没有经历过类似问题或者好的解决方法”。然后一般会贴出出错的信息或者有关的资料。发邮件时候不会先发一封"在吗?"去问问路,要要问问题也就直接问,不要等回一句"什么问题?"。
https://www.entrepreneur.com/article/254264 里列出了经典的问题:How to Ask the Right Question in the Right Way
最重要的是两点:1. ask friendly 2. clarify quesitons
。
这两点都可以做到的话能得到 proper response 的概率还是很大的。
最后还是想说这个问题真的挺常见的,某颜色一条街动不动就是"XX 有 XX 的进来"(不打全称了),某数字八卦小组也经常是"进来的小仙女瘦十斤",我.......
这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。
V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。
V2EX is a community of developers, designers and creative people.